Why Diet Matters More Than Exercise
Many beginners think spending hours in the gym is enough to get fit. However, exercise without proper nutrition is like driving a car without fuel. Your body needs quality nutrients to:
- Build muscle
- Burn fat
- Increase energy
- Improve recovery
- Support metabolism
- Maintain strength
A proper gym diet plan helps your body perform better and recover faster. Without balanced nutrition, even the best workout routine will produce slow results.
Understanding Balanced Nutrition for Fitness Goals
A healthy fitness diet is built around three important nutrients:
Protein
Carbohydrates
Healthy Fats
These nutrients work together to help you achieve your fitness goals.
Protein – The Foundation of Muscle Building
Protein is one of the most important parts of beginner fitness nutrition. It helps repair and build muscles after workouts.
If you are serious about muscle gain diet planning or weight loss diet improvement, protein should be included in every meal.
Best Protein Sources in Pakistan
- Eggs
- Chicken breast
- Fish
- Daal
- Yogurt
- Milk
- Paneer
- Beef (lean cuts)
- Dry fruits
- Peanut butter
How Much Protein Do Beginners Need?
Gym beginners should aim for moderate protein intake daily. Even simple foods like eggs, chicken, and daal can provide excellent results when eaten consistently.
Healthy Carbohydrates – Your Body’s Energy Source
Carbohydrates are often misunderstood. Many people avoid carbs completely, but healthy carbs are essential for workout energy.
Without carbs, you may feel tired, weak, and unable to train properly.
Healthy Carb Options
- Oats
- Brown rice
- Whole wheat roti
- Fruits
- Sweet potatoes
- Vegetables
- Bananas
Healthy carbohydrates fuel your workouts and support muscle recovery.
Healthy Fats – Important for Hormones & Recovery
Healthy fats help maintain energy levels and support overall health.
Good Fat Sources
- Almonds
- Walnuts
- Peanut butter
- Olive oil
- Avocados
- Seeds
- Fish oil
Avoid unhealthy oily and fried foods as much as possible.
Water Intake & Hydration
Hydration is one of the most ignored parts of healthy eating for gym performance.
Water helps:
- Improve workouts
- Prevent fatigue
- Support digestion
- Boost metabolism
- Improve recovery
Daily Water Intake Tips
- Drink water throughout the day
- Carry a water bottle to the gym
- Drink water before and after workouts
- Avoid excessive soft drinks
A hydrated body performs much better during exercise.
Meal Timing for Gym Beginners
Meal timing is important because your body needs fuel before exercise and recovery nutrition after workouts.
Best Time to Eat Before Workout
Eat a balanced meal 1–2 hours before training.
Good Pre-Workout Foods
- Banana with peanut butter
- Oats with milk
- Brown bread with eggs
- Yogurt with fruits
These meals provide energy and improve workout performance.
Post-Workout Meals for Muscle Recovery
After exercise, your body needs protein and carbohydrates to recover.
Best Post-Workout Foods
- Chicken with rice
- Eggs and roti
- Protein shake
- Yogurt with oats
- Daal with brown rice
Post-workout nutrition supports muscle growth and faster recovery.
Common Beginner Diet Mistakes
Many gym beginners struggle because of poor eating habits.
1. Skipping Meals
Skipping meals slows metabolism and reduces energy.
2. Eating Too Much Junk Food
Fast food and sugary drinks make fat loss difficult.
3. Not Eating Enough Protein
Low protein intake slows muscle recovery.
4. Drinking Very Little Water
Dehydration affects workout performance.
5. Following Extreme Diets
Crash diets are unhealthy and difficult to maintain.
Consistency is more important than perfection.
Foods to Avoid for Better Fitness Results
If you want faster results, reduce these foods:
- Soft drinks
- Excess sugar
- Deep-fried foods
- Bakery items
- Fast food
- Processed snacks
- Excess oily foods
You do not need to completely stop eating your favorite foods, but moderation is important.
Budget-Friendly Diet Tips for Pakistani Gym Beginners
Healthy eating does not have to be expensive.
Affordable Healthy Foods
Eggs
One of the cheapest and best protein sources.
Daal
Rich in protein and nutrients.
Seasonal Fruits
Affordable and healthy.
Oats
Budget-friendly breakfast option.
Yogurt
Great for digestion and protein.
Chicken
Simple and effective for muscle gain.
Roti & Rice
Healthy in moderate portions.
Fitness success comes from consistency, not expensive diets.
Complete Beginner Gym Diet Plan
Here is a simple beginner-friendly gym diet plan suitable for Pakistani lifestyles.
Breakfast
- 3 boiled eggs
- 1 cup oats with milk
- 1 banana
- Green tea or black coffee
This meal provides energy and protein for the day.
Mid-Morning Snack
- Handful of almonds or walnuts
- Yogurt
- Apple or orange
Healthy snacks help control hunger and maintain energy.
Lunch
- Grilled chicken or daal
- 2 whole wheat rotis
- Salad
- Yogurt
Balanced lunch supports muscle growth and recovery.
Evening Snack
- Peanut butter sandwich
- Fruit smoothie
- Black tea without sugar
A light snack keeps energy levels stable.
Dinner
- Chicken, fish, or daal
- Brown rice or roti
- Vegetables
- Salad
Keep dinner balanced and avoid overeating late at night.

Weight Loss Diet vs Muscle Gain Diet
Many beginners ask whether diet plans are different for weight loss and muscle gain.
The answer is yes — but the basics remain the same.
Weight Loss Diet
- Moderate calories
- High protein
- Less junk food
- More vegetables
- Controlled portions
Muscle Gain Diet
- Higher protein intake
- More healthy carbohydrates
- Consistent meals
- Strength training support
Both require discipline and balanced nutrition.
